Warning Signs You Need Slab Leak Water Removal
Ignoring the signs of a slab leak can lead to costly repairs and even structural damage. Look out for these warning signs and don’t wait until it’s too late.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a persistent, unpleasant odor in your home, it could be a sign of a slab leak. Don’t ignore it, contact our team for a thorough inspection.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
If your flooring is warped or buckled, it may be a sign of a slab leak. Don’t delay, schedule a repair service today.
Water Stains or Discoloration
Water stains or discoloration on your walls or ceilings can show a slab leak. Don’t wait, contact our team for a prompt repair.
Increased Water Bills
If your water bills are suddenly higher than usual, it could be a sign of a slab leak. Don’t ignore it, schedule a repair service today.
Unusual Noises or Vibrations
If you notice unusual noises or vibrations in your home, it may be a sign of a slab leak. Don’t delay, contact our team for a thorough inspection.

Slab Leak Water Removal Cost In Puyallup, WA
The cost of slab leak water removal in Puyallup, WA varies depending on the severity of the leak,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the complexity of the repair.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Leak detection | $200 – $500 | Size of affected area, complexity of leak |
| Repair and replacement |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, complexity of repair, materials required |
| Cleanup and drying |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, level of water damage |
| Final inspection and verification | $100 – $300 | Complexity of repair, level of water damage |
| Insurance claim documentation | $100 – $500 | Complexity of claim, level of documentation required |
| Hidden leak detection |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, complexity of leak |
